Stars can meet their end in several ways, each with its own unique set of circumstances. Supernovae, for example, occur when a massive star exhausts its nuclear fuel and collapses under the force of its gravity. This cataclysmic event produces an explosion that can outshine entire galaxies. However, it is unclear if the star in question met such a dramatic fate.

Alternatively, stars can also die more quietly, gradually shedding their outer layers and forming what is known as a planetary nebula. This process typically occurs in lower-mass stars, like our own sun, as they reach the end of their life cycle. Could the star’s death be attributed to this more serene process?
